They’re using covers from later than the 80s- I thought that wasn’t allowed? Both the Adam Lambert and Glee versions are much more recent
 
They’re using covers from later than the 80s- I thought that wasn’t allowed? Both the Adam Lambert and Glee versions are much more recent

Here is the exact wording of the rules:

"The theme selected for the Rhythm Dances for both Junior and Senior for the season 2023/24 is “Music and Feeling of the Eighties”. Any music is possible provided it was originally released in the decade of the 1980s. The couple should demonstrate through dance the culture and feeling/essence of this decade. The selected music may be remastered. The Rhythm Dance should NOT be skated in the style of a Free Dance. The couple must use dance movements and dance holds to interpret the chosen music from this decade."

Source: https://www.isu.org/inside-isu/isu-communications/communications/31243-isu-communication-2560/file (top of page 2)​

Although the word itself does not appear, there are two key sentences that appear to refer to covers.

The first, "Any music is possible provided it was originally released in the decade of the 1980s", appears to be an explicit instruction that 80's covers of earlier songs are not allowed.

The second, "The selected music may be remastered", suggests to me that they will allow later covers of songs that were originally released in the 80's.

So, I take it that Charlène, Marco and their team are looking at this second sentence in the same way that I did.

But, it looks like ISU are not being strict on this, because we have already seen programmes that do not conform to the rules (e.g. Ashlie and Atl using Run-DMC's 1986 cover of "Walk This Way", a song that was originally released in 1975 by Aerosmith).
